The Art of Kanazawa Gold Leaf: A 450-Year Legacy of Brilliance

Kanazawa Gold Leaf is a traditional craft from Kanazawa City in Ishikawa Prefecture, boasting a history of over 450 years and accounting for more than 99% of Japan's gold leaf production. Its creation was encouraged by Toshiie Maeda, the first lord of the Kaga Domain, and its techniques were carefully preserved and refined in secrecy during the Edo period.
Blessed by Kanazawa's climate and high-quality water, the craft is renowned for the artisans' unparalleled ability to meticulously hammer gold into sheets as thin as 1/10,000th of a millimeter. Kanazawa Gold Leaf has been used in a wide range of applications, from Buddhist altars, lacquerware, and folding screens to modern interior design and fashion. Its radiant brilliance and exceptional quality continue to captivate and inspire across generations.

Hakuichi: Bridging Tradition and Innovation in Kanazawa Gold Leaf Craftsmanship

Based in Kanazawa City, Ishikawa Prefecture, Hakuichi is a renowned traditional craft brand dedicated to preserving the 450-year-old art of Kanazawa gold leaf. With Kanazawa producing 99% of Japan’s gold leaf, Hakuichi stands as a leading company committed to passing down this exceptional craftsmanship to future generations while innovating across diverse product lines.
Beyond traditional gold leaf crafts, Hakuichi expands the appeal of gold leaf into cosmetics, food, architecture, and interior design, continually exploring new possibilities for this timeless art form.
